Job Summary

Progressive Technology is seeking diligent and detail-oriented housewives interested in flexible work-from-home opportunities involving typing and form filling tasks. This role offers an excellent chance to earn income from the comfort of your home while managing your household responsibilities. The ideal candidate will possess basic computer skills, accuracy in data entry, and the ability to work independently to complete assigned tasks efficiently.

Key Responsibilities

  • Accurately type and fill various online and offline forms as assigned.

  • Ensure all entered data is error-free and submitted within deadlines.

  • Maintain confidentiality of sensitive information and data integrity.

  • Communicate regularly with the supervisor regarding task progress and any issues encountered.

  • Manage and organize documents related to typing and form filling assignments.

  • Adapt to changing tasks and follow instructions precisely to meet quality standards.

Required Skills and Qualifications

  • Proficiency in basic typing skills with a minimum typing speed of 25-30 words per minute.

  • Familiarity with computers, internet navigation, and Microsoft Office or equivalent software.

  • Good command of English or the local language for accurate data entry.

  • Ability to follow instructions carefully and work with minimal supervision.

  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to accuracy.

  • Reliable internet connection and a personal computer or laptop.

Experience

  • No prior professional experience required; freshers and beginners are welcome to apply.

  • Experience in data entry, typing, or form filling is a plus but not mandatory.

  • Housewives looking to start or resume their career with flexible home-based work are encouraged to apply.

Working Hours

  • Flexible working hours to accommodate household duties and personal schedules.

  • Workload may vary based on task availability, offering an opportunity for part-time or full-time engagement.

  • Candidates can choose their working hours within given deadlines.
